Output 5ba4b373dd617a350651db99ee0a48345f46ee71cbe551580a6a149ea966d95d:27

value
949576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eabfd4067b7d6a8a719dd3bce553fd5923a64561 OP_EQUAL
address
3P6FqtcgNQ2WBCsDoBwSvzYWbw31D3fSA4
transaction
5ba4b373dd617a350651db99ee0a48345f46ee71cbe551580a6a149ea966d95d